如何在在线网站进行数据可视化图表制作?

随着互联网的飞速发展,数据已经成为企业决策的重要依据。为了更好地分析数据,将数据转化为直观的图表成为了一种趋势。那么,如何在在线网站进行数据可视化图表制作呢?本文将为您详细介绍。

一、选择合适的在线数据可视化工具

目前市面上有很多在线数据可视化工具,如Tableau、Power BI、百度ECharts等。以下是几种常见的在线数据可视化工具:

  • Tableau:Tableau是一款功能强大的数据可视化工具,可以轻松地将数据转换为各种图表,如柱状图、折线图、饼图等。
  • Power BI:Power BI是微软推出的一款商业智能工具,可以与企业级数据源进行连接,制作交互式图表。
  • 百度ECharts:百度ECharts是一款基于JavaScript的数据可视化库,支持多种图表类型,如折线图、柱状图、散点图等。

在选择在线数据可视化工具时,需要根据自身需求、数据类型和预算等因素进行综合考虑。

二、数据预处理

在进行数据可视化之前,需要对数据进行预处理,确保数据的准确性和完整性。以下是数据预处理的一些常见步骤:

  1. 数据清洗:删除重复数据、填补缺失值、处理异常值等。
  2. 数据转换:将数据转换为适合可视化的格式,如将日期转换为时间戳、将文本转换为数值等。
  3. 数据筛选:根据需求筛选出所需的数据。

三、选择合适的图表类型

不同的数据类型和展示需求需要选择不同的图表类型。以下是几种常见的图表类型:

  • 柱状图:适用于比较不同类别之间的数据,如销售额、用户数量等。
  • 折线图:适用于展示数据随时间变化的趋势,如股票价格、气温等。
  • 饼图:适用于展示不同类别数据在整体中的占比,如市场份额、年龄段分布等。
  • 散点图:适用于展示两个变量之间的关系,如身高与体重的关系。

四、设计图表

在设计图表时,需要注意以下几点:

  1. 图表标题:简洁明了地描述图表内容。
  2. 坐标轴:坐标轴的标签清晰易懂,单位正确。
  3. 颜色搭配:颜色搭配要和谐,避免使用过多的颜色。
  4. 交互功能:如可缩放、可旋转、可切换视图等。

五、案例分析

以下是一个使用百度ECharts制作柱状图的案例:

  1. 数据准备:获取某公司最近三个月的销售额数据。
  2. 代码编写
// 引入百度ECharts主模块
var echarts = require('echarts/lib/echarts');
// 引入柱状图
require('echarts/lib/chart/bar');

// 基于准备好的dom,初始化echarts实例
var myChart = echarts.init(document.getElementById('main'));

// 指定图表的配置项和数据
var option = {
title: {
text: '某公司最近三个月销售额'
},
tooltip: {},
legend: {
data:['销售额']
},
xAxis: {
data: ["1月", "2月", "3月"]
},
yAxis: {},
series: [{
name: '销售额',
type: 'bar',
data: [20000, 25000, 30000]
}]
};

// 使用刚指定的配置项和数据显示图表。
myChart.setOption(option);

  1. 效果展示
    柱状图示例

通过以上步骤,您可以在在线网站进行数据可视化图表制作。希望本文对您有所帮助!

猜你喜欢:网络流量分发